Support Your Child’s Writing Practice with Inspiring Jewish Americans

Looking for a meaningful way to support your child’s writing development at school or at home? This engaging 
Jewish American Heroes Writing Workbook is perfect for homeschooling families, classroom teachers, and ELD teachers who want to combine history, reading comprehension, grammar, and handwriting practice—all in one easy-to-use resource.
Your student will discover 
famous Jewish Americans throughout U.S. history through kid-friendly lists that highlight simple facts about each individual. After reading, they’ll:

Write complete sentences using the information provided
Edit their own work for grammar and punctuation
Create a final copy with neat handwriting
Color a fun illustration of each historical figure as a reward

For more advanced learners, extend the activity by having them research the Jewish Americans and then 
write a full paragraph with connected sentences, promoting critical thinking and written expression.
A special 
pronouns reference page is included to help your child vary their sentence structure while reinforcing grammar skills.

Whether you're teaching 
elementary writing, supporting an English Language Learner (ELL), or celebrating Jewish American Heritage Month, this workbook is a great way to integrate language arts and social studies in a fun and educational way.

People Included: Asser Levy, Bilhah Abigail Levy Franks, Haym Salomon, Judah Touro, Rebecca Gratz, Penina Moïse, Levi Strauss, Emma Lazarus, Hinda Amchanitzky, Hannah Greenebaum Solomon, Lillian Wald, Albert Einstein, Rose Schneiderman, Ray Frank, Beatrice Alexander, Bob Marshall, Ezra Jack Keats, Bella Abzug, Ruth Bader Ginsburg, Jeffrey Hoffman, Robert Lawrence Stine (R. L. Stine), Sally Priesand, Debbie Friedman
